At the heart of the Mercedes-Benz Sprinter Bus is its robust engine lineup, offering power outputs ranging from 114 PS to an impressive 190 PS. These variants ensure that there is a model suitable for every requirement, whether you need efficient city commuting or robust highway cruising.
The Sprinter Bus is equipped with either a manual or automatic transmission, providing flexibility to suit different driving preferences. The sophisticated 9G-TRONIC automatic gearbox represents a pinnacle of automotive engineering, ensuring smooth and efficient gear changes, which enhance the overall driving experience.
The Sprinter Bus's diesel engines are not just about power; they also focus on fuel efficiency, with consumption figures between 9.3 L/100km and 12.3 L/100km. The inclusion of start/stop technology helps in reducing fuel consumption, thus making it more economical and environmentally friendly.
Mercedes-Benz shows its commitment to sustainability by ensuring all engine options comply with stringent emissions standards. The models provide a CO2 efficiency class of G, underlining the brand's dedication to creating vehicles that are as kind to the planet as they are to your pocket.
The design of the Mercedes-Benz Sprinter Bus effortlessly combines functionality with aesthetics. The interior space is crafted to provide maximum comfort for passengers, while the exterior design leaves a lasting impression with its sleek lines and authoritative presence.
The Sprinter Bus can accommodate up to nine seats, making it ideal for passenger transport. Options such as air conditioning, advanced infotainment systems, and ergonomic seating ensure a pleasant experience for both driver and passengers, even on long journeys.
The Sprinter Bus offers a suite of advanced safety features aimed at keeping occupants safe, including adaptive cruise control, lane keep assist, and crosswind assist. These features are integrated with cutting-edge technology, such as the Mercedes-Benz User Experience (MBUX) system, which enhances connectivity and user interaction.
With rear-wheel drive and optional all-wheel drive capabilities, the Sprinter Bus is equipped to handle a variety of terrains and weather conditions, providing reassurance for every journey.
Mercedes-Benz demonstrates their innovative edge with customisation options tailored to various business needs, be it for luxury transport or robust utility. Additionally, the Sprinter Bus's load capacity ranges from 814 kg to 1,249 kg, ensuring businesses can meet their logistical needs efficiently.

The Lynk & Co 08 is undeniably an SUV at heart, boasting a body type designed to blend elegance with practicality. With a length of 4820 mm and a height of 1690 mm, it presents a commanding presence on the road. Its sleek, aerodynamic lines are complemented by a modern silhouette, ensuring it stands out in a crowd. The five-door configuration ensures easy access, making it family-friendly yet trendy.
At the core of the Lynk & Co 08 is its innovative plugin hybrid technology. This SUV is equipped with a 1.5TD engine, powered by a 1.5L engine capacity, showcasing both power and efficiency. Its 349 HP (257 kW) and a 0-100 km/h acceleration in just 7.7 seconds underline its performance credentials while the remarkable fuel consumption of 0.9 L/100 km underscores its commitment to sustainability.
The Lynk & Co 08 comes with an automatic gearbox transmission coupled with front-wheel drive, ensuring a seamless and responsive driving experience. Its 42 L fuel tank capacity complements an electric range of 200 km, rivalling many in the hybrid category. Whether tackling city traffic or venturing on the open road, this SUV maintains poise with a maximum speed of 200 km/h.
Inside, the Lynk & Co 08 offers seating for up to five passengers, emphasizing a sophisticated layout that combines luxury with functionality.
